CACI is seeking a motivated Data Scientist (AI/ML Engineer) to develop and deploy complex Artificial Intelligence systems in support of defending the Department of Defense Air Force Information Network (AFIN). This role requires the application of advanced anomaly detection algorithms for identifying and isolating malicious threats. Methodologies will include, but are not limited to, supervised and unsupervised learning, Graph Neural Networks, and Deep Learning models. The Data Scientist will collaborate with a core group of senior software engineers and analytic developers to curate various technical products such as Big Data analytics, data dashboard visualizations, and cross-domain data traversal solutions. These products will equip our customers with the tools and knowledge necessary to better understand, plan, manage, and safeguard the AFIN. The candidate must be able to work within a fast-paced and cutting-edge team. You will drive our cyber threat intelligence and detection mission by providing expert leadership and mentorship in the application of advanced AI/ML solutions. Additional responsibilities will include assisting in cultivating analyst/end-user experience, data visualization, designing documentation, coding, code reviews, and analytic testing. You will also provide technical direction and research capabilities to the team responsible for the design, implementation, testing, deployment, and operation of the 35th IS’s cyber threat intelligence detection methods and the systems enabling their execution.
